Coming close to its 30th birthday, the Cleveland Museum of Art’s Parade the Circle is just around the corner. More than 40 non-profits take part in the parade, dressed in extravagant outfits and costumes, and local schools and community groups are invited to join in the parade too, with workshops being offered to teach leaders how to design and create costumes and floats.  Vendors and onsite arts and crafts will be present as well. Parade the Circle is Saturday June 10th at Wade Oval, with the parade starting at 12, and the Village Circle open from 11 to 4.
